Tangent
A side scrolling shooter in which you fly a spaceship through futuristic environments and must destroy a set number of enemies to advance to the next stage. Your ship can fly into two directions and a radar at the top of the screen shows the enemies' position. Carefully adjust your ship's speed to keep up with the enemies without crashing into them. Colliding with enemy ships or getting hit by enemy fire decreases your ship's energy bar. At the end of each level, you get the chance to destroy a large mothership for bonus points. Getting hit by a mothership does not damage your ship, but throws you into the next stage without bonus. As the game progresses, new enemy formations attack you, standard enemies become more numerous and faster, while motherships get bigger and carry more weapons.
